NCAA TOURNAMENT ROUND 2: No. 8 Wisconsin vs No. 1 Villanova
Matchup
No. 8 seeded Wisconsin (26-9 overall, 12-6 Big Ten) vs. No. 1 seeded Villanova (32-3 overall, 15-3 Big East)
When & Where
Saturday, Mar. 18 | 1:40 p.m. CST | Buffalo, NY

At a Glance
The No. 25 Wisconsin Badgers have cleared their first hurdle in the NCAA Tournament and will now face the No. 1 ranked Villanova Wildcats for a chance to advance to the Sweet 16. The matchup to watch will be the Badgers stiff defense up against the Wildcats high-flying offense in what should prove to be one of the most entertaining games of the Round of 32.

Last Time Out
When Bronson Koenig finds his stroke there is little opposing teams can do to slow down the talented senior guard and that's exactly what happened in UW’s opening round as Koenig hit eight 3-pointers in the Badgers' 10-point win over Virginia Tech. But it wasn’t all easy. With 2:25 left on the clock the Hokies only trailed the Badgers by a single point, but Wisconsin showed better consistency at the penalty stripe and managed to pull away in the final moments.
Bronson Koenig – 28 points, 3 rebounds, 3 assists
Nigel Hayes – 16 points 10 rebounds, 3 assists
Ethan Happ – 10 points, 8 rebounds, 2 assists, 3 blocks, 1 steal
Quick Facts
- The Badgers are the No. 22 most efficient team in the nation according to Kenpom.com.
- Wisconsin has won more NCAA Tournament games (12) in the past four years than any other team in the nation.
- UW has advanced to the Sweet Sixteen in the past consecutive seasons.

Villanova Wildcats
Head Coach
Jay Wright: 372-157 (.704)
Last Time Out
Mount Saint Mary’s was leading the defending champions 10 seconds into the second half and it appeared that the Wildcats maybe were more average than people had thought. Then Villanova went on 13-0 run and the Mountaineers Cinderella tale fell to the hardwood. Less than 20 minutes later the explosive Big East champions had opened the lead up to 20 points and showed the nation they are here to repeat as they rolled over The Mount, 76-56.
Quick Facts
- The Wildcats are the No. 2 most efficient team in the nation according to Kenpom.com.
- Villanova hasn’t played Wisconsin since 1995 when they beat the Badger 66-58.
- ESPN' BPI gives VU a 77 percent chance to win versus Wisconsin.
